A rifle is a special kind of long gun made for hitting targets far away. It's like a super-powered pencil that shoots tiny metal sticks called bullets! Most rifles are held with two hands and rested on your shoulder to keep them steady. They are used by soldiers, police officers, and even people who love shooting sports or hunting for food.
Twisty Barrels Make Super Aim!
What makes a rifle so accurate? It's all in the barrel! Inside, there are twisty grooves, like a tiny spiral slide. When a bullet zooms down this slide, it spins really fast. This spin is like a gyroscope, making the bullet fly straight and true, even from a long distance. Older guns didn't have this twisty trick and weren't nearly as accurate.
From Old Guns to Super Spinners
Long, long ago, people used guns called muskets. They were okay, but not very accurate. Then, someone had a brilliant idea to put twisty grooves inside the gun's barrel. This invention, called rifling, made guns much, much better at hitting their targets. This new kind of gun was called a 'rifled gun,' and that's how we got the name 'rifle'!
More Than Just for Soldiers!
Rifles aren't just for fighting. They are also used for fun! People use them in shooting sports to see who can hit a target the best. Some people use special air-powered rifles to shoot at targets for practice, or even to help control small pests around farms. It's amazing how this invention has so many different uses!
